怎么在本地服务器上安装ssl

在本地服务器上安装SSL证书通常涉及以下几个步骤:

创新互联长期为超过千家客户提供的网站建设服务,团队从业经验10年,关注不同地域、不同群体,并针对不同对象提供差异化的产品和服务;打造开放共赢平台,与合作伙伴共同营造健康的互联网生态环境。为柴桑企业提供专业的成都网站设计、做网站,柴桑网站改版等技术服务。拥有10年丰富建站经验和众多成功案例,为您定制开发。

1. 获取SSL证书

购买SSL证书:从证书颁发机构(CA)如Verisign, Let’s Encrypt等购买SSL证书。

生成自签名证书:对于测试或内部使用,可以生成自签名的SSL证书。

2. 安装证书

2.1 安装到Web服务器

Apache

将证书文件(通常包括.crt.key文件)上传到服务器。

修改Apache配置文件(通常是httpd.confapache2.conf)。

添加或修改VirtualHost配置,指定SSL证书和私钥的位置。

Nginx

将证书文件上传到服务器。

修改Nginx配置文件(通常是nginx.conf)。

server块中添加ssl_certificatessl_certificate_key指令,指定证书和私钥的路径。

IIS

通过IIS管理器导入SSL证书。

绑定证书到相应的网站。

2.2 安装到邮件服务器

Postfix

编辑postfix的主配置文件(通常是/etc/postfix/main.cf)。

设置smtpd_tls_cert_filesmtpd_tls_key_file参数,指向证书和私钥文件。

Exchange

通过Exchange管理控制台导入SSL证书。

将证书分配给相应的服务(如SMTP, IMAP等)。

3. 配置服务器

防火墙设置:确保防火墙允许HTTPS(默认端口443)流量。

负载均衡器:如果使用负载均衡器,确保其配置正确,以支持SSL终止或直通。

4. 测试证书安装

使用工具如openssl命令行工具测试SSL连接。

使用在线SSL检查工具,如SSL Labs的SSL Server Test,来验证证书安装是否正确。

5. 更新网站链接

将所有HTTP链接更新为HTTPS。

如果适用,设置HTTP到HTTPS的重定向。

6. 监控和维护

定期检查证书有效期,并及时更新。

监控服务器日志,确保没有SSL相关的错误或警告。

这些步骤提供了在本地服务器上安装SSL证书的基本指南,具体步骤可能会根据服务器类型、操作系统和使用的Web服务器软件有所不同。

当前文章:怎么在本地服务器上安装ssl
网页地址:http://www.mswzjz.cn/qtweb/news12/220862.html

攀枝花网站建设、攀枝花网站运维推广公司-贝锐智能,是专注品牌与效果的网络营销公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 贝锐智能